Drosophila hemipeza is an endangered fruit fly that is only found on the Hawaiian island of Oahu and known from seven localities. Larvae feed on rotting bark of Urera kaalae, an endangered plant that lives on slopes and gulches. In 2004, only 40 individual U. kaalae were known to remain. Assume a generation time of 0.1 and an effective/adult ratio of 0.012 for D. hemipeza. A: Assuming that each plant can support 100 adult D. hemipeza, if the plant population is maintained at 40 individuals does D. hemipeza face a significant loss (>10%) of genetic diversity over the following 10 years? B: If not, how many plants should be added to meet the conservation goals for D. hemipeza?
